CompTIA has specified more than fifteen objectives for the 220-302 test, which are grouped under four topics. Following are some important areas in which an individual should possess good knowledge before taking the 220-302 test:

  1. Major desktop components and interfaces, and their functions.

  2. Major operating system components such as Registry, virtual memory, and file systems.

  3. Major operating system interfaces such as Windows Explorer, Control Panel, etc.

  4. Names, locations, purposes, and contents of major system files.

  5. Command line functions and utilities to manage the operating system.

  6. Various file systems.

  7. Installation and upgrade of all versions of Windows operating systems.

  8. Optimization of an operating system and its subsystems.

  9. Diagnosing and troubleshooting the operating system's problems.

  10. Basic networking capabilities of Windows operating system.

  11. Basic Internet protocols and terminologies.
